Transaction 4341a75cfe9986edd134ae1ea8872e5d91acfd15ea70ea845d916e2e94b05d9d

1 Input
1 Outputs
  • 4341a75cfe9986edd134ae1ea8872e5d91acfd15ea70ea845d916e2e94b05d9d:0
  • value  4157911
    address  3EgPzFxGuqzvfGbYwHLUEq9yrCKomM7QuQ